What does a USA operations manager do?

A USA Operations Manager oversees the daily operations of a business within the United States, ensuring that processes run efficiently and align with company goals. Their responsibilities typically include managing teams, optimizing supply chains, implementing policies, and coordinating between departments. They also analyze performance data, set operational budgets, and drive improvements to increase productivity and profitability.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ills are essential for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a USA operations man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a USA Operations Manager, you need strong leadership, organizational, and analytical skills, often supported by a bachelor's degree in business administration or a related field. Familiarity with en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ems, project management software, and supply chain management tools is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and adaptability are critical soft skills that distinguish top performers. These skills ensure efficient operations, effective team management, and the ability to drive business growth in a competitive environment.

How does a USA operations manager typically collaborate with cross-functional teams to drive operational efficiency?

A USA Operations Manager frequently works alongside departments such as logistics, sales, finance, and human resources to ensure seamless business operations. This collaboration often involves regular meetings to align on goals, address process bottlenecks, and implement best practices across various functions. By fostering strong communication channels and leveraging data from different teams, Operations Managers can identify areas for improvement and drive initiatives that enhance overall efficiency. Effective collaboration is essential for resolving challenges quickly and supporting company growth.

Job description

Dispatcher/Operations (Under DTS)
Full-Time
Location: Coach USA โ€“ The Loop in Parkville, MD
Compensation: Annual Salary: $52,000 Based upon experience
Schedule: Must be flexible with time and days throughout the week (Operations is Monday-Saturday)

You will be responsible for coordinating vehicle and driver schedules and troubleshooting issues which arise due to driver and/or equipment changes, customer needs and other planned and unplanned events. Requirements:

  • Assign drivers and buses
  • Update and monitor GPS route/ equipment status
  • Monitor on-time performance
  • Check driverโ€™s credentials and logs
  • Monitor compliance hours
  • Inspect and sign DVIR
  • Provide available and OOS bus list along with fleet count, monitor PM list
  • Make sure all company vehicles and buses are fueled and cleaned
  • Report all accidents/incidents to Safety Director/ General Manager/ VP Operations-Central
  • Assist customer inquiries through phone or email
  • In case of breakdowns contact road services, dispatch relief bus, and notify Director of Maintenance and management.
  • Communicate delays or updates with Operations
  • Communicate with maintenance on breakdowns, defects, and PMs
  • Council and direct drivers
  • Monitor GPS and maps to keep drivers on schedule from traffic and accidents
  • Transfer and receive information from shift to shift
  • Other duties as needed

Required Experience:
  •  At least 1 to 2 years previous driving and/or dispatching experience or 5 years of transportation industry preferred

Qualifications:
  • Ability to multitask and trouble shoot in a high pace environment
  • Available on weekends, holidays, days, and nights
  • Exemplary communication and customer service skills
  • Knowledgeable in data entry, internet usage, email, Microsoft Office, Excel, and web-based routing / GPS programs
  • A clear understanding of e-logโ€™s
  • The ability to possess and maintain CDL-A or B License with Air Brakes and Passenger Endorsement
